#dd2d23 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dd2d23 is composed of 86.7% red, 17.6%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.6% magenta, 84.2%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 3.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 50.2%. #dd2d23 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5a46 with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#dd2d23

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fdf0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d2d23

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#857b7b is the less saturated color, while #fa1306 is the most saturated one.
